Make ‘N’ PlayMake ‘N’ Play is an art and messy play group for young children and their parents/carers.
Our sessions are an hour long, where your child will have the opportunity to enjoy a variety of play. Children can explore messy play, sensory play and simple art & craft activities, finishing with a short singing time, a drink and a biscuit! Mainly aimed at under 5 year olds, but we will also be running through the school holidays and older siblings are very welcome. Southsea SanghaSouthsea Sangha is an independent peer led dharma meditation community, based in the heart of Southsea, founded in 2014.
Founded in 2014 by Daniel Sutton-Johanson, with the help of local practitioners, Southsea Sangha is passionate about inclusive community building, around the intersections of meditation, dharma, social justice and collective freedom. We are committed to what bell hooks named as “Spirit, Struggle, Service & Love”, values the Buddha also taught to motivate progressive and compassionate social change. A key driver for our community is to broaden access to spiritual community practice and therefore, a principle tenet of our community has and continues to be, that of a generosity ethic. This allows us to disrupt, and where possible, remove the transactional barriers many folks face when wishing to explore personal wellbeing and healing work within spiritual practices and wisdom traditions that acknowledge the social and political contexts in which we encounter them. Our programs offer wisdom teachings and practices from pan-Buddhist lineages right across to secular mindfulness and are freely offered. We offer day long retreats, weekly online classes and in-person practice groups to a diverse community who wish to explore, begin or expand a personal dharma practice informed by mindfulness, compassion, kindness, wisdom and generosity. You don’t need to be Buddhist to meditate or to just come hang with us and others at Sangha. You are very welcome just as you are. Bring it all. All our regular groups and classes are freely offered with no advance booking needed. We exist to serve our community, both locally and online. 89 Clarendon Road

The Elizabeth FoundationThe Elizabeth Foundation is a charity supporting infants and preschool children with all degrees of deafness and their families. We are inclusive of children with additional physical, sensory and specialist learning needs. Our experienced team of professionals support children with all degrees of deafness to learn to listen and speak using the multi-sensory oral/aural approach, which engages all of a child's senses in natural, fun and child-centred activities that support communication development.

The Parenting Network - Baby BankThe Portsmouth Baby Bank aims to help alleviate child poverty and support families during times of financial and emotional stress, whilst reducing waste and promoting reuse of items.
We collect baby clothes, maternity items, toiletries, equipment, cots, prams and toys that are pre-loved, and pass them on to families in need. Our service is provided free of charge and we receive referrals from a whole range of professionals who are in contact with families. |
